Output 7519585bd24e7ee2f066cf9bbaec4b1430cf8da1787a1f9c790c9979593a355f:0

value
17140686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1957122050df971042438a54eb6b981a846e7ea OP_EQUAL
address
3LoCB3TyZEQhFMCRwpx1pgTAMBrcW4cDSj
transaction
7519585bd24e7ee2f066cf9bbaec4b1430cf8da1787a1f9c790c9979593a355f
spent
true